Let's start at the beginning. For any listeners who don't know, what is Baseten and how do you start working on it?

**Tuhin Srivastava** (0:29)
Baseten is an infrastructure product, so we provide fast scalable AI infrastructure for engineering teams working with large models. Currently, we're focused on inference and we want to do a lot more after that. But for the past, say, four and a half years actually, that's a long time, for the last four and a half years, we've been cutting our teeth and trying to build this thing. I think it's been pretty rewarding over the last 12 months seeing the market show up and everyone get equally excited about AI infrastructure.

You often say that Baseten isn't no code, it's efficient code. Why does that difference matter?

**Tuhin Srivastava** (1:20)
That wasn't always the case, I'd say. I'd say there was times when we had elements which were definitely a bit no-code-y. I think what we've learned over the last three or four years is code is just incredibly powerful and engineers want to write code. Even in its best form, you want to build really, really tight abstractions, but I think the ability to turn the knobs under the hood is very, very important. I think no-code makes that a lot harder. I don't think it removes it, but it makes it a lot harder.
So what we do is just build very strong intuitive abstractions that try to make the easy things super easy and still make the hard things possible.
So you can get a lot of value really quickly, but I say, unlike a lot of other infrastructure products that have been built over the last 10 years, we're trying to solve against the graduation problem, which is that we're able to support teams as they grow in scale.

And just to sort of make it a little bit more visceral for our listeners, like what are the types of applications that run on Baseten? Like what's the scale of the platform? Do you have a favorite application?

**Tuhin Srivastava** (2:25)
Everything from tiny side projects on weekends, all the way to companies that are pretty AI native. We've supported foundation model companies. We work with companies like Descript, where AI is very, very cool to the product experience. We power a lot of AI features that Patreon has shipped. But I'd say some of the more interesting use cases from our perspective actually, or my perspective at least, are either the really small teams that we're giving a lot of leverage to, so that they can ship things very quickly. So a really good example of that might be a company like Planned AI, which is basically building an SDK for call centers, is how I describe it. But they're able to ship models and co-locate workloads so that they can get sub 300 millisecond or sub 200 millisecond responses without months and months of infrastructure effort. I think on the other hand, it's really exciting to see companies become AI enabled.
That's where we see a lot of the value is going to be over the next decade is, if I look at a company like Picnic Health, which has actually been around for a decade and starting to do very, very interesting thing with this corpus of data that they've gathered over the last 10 years and supporting those use cases, I think their models could Picnic GPT, which extracts information from medical records. And to me, those are the really exciting use cases where you're giving leverage to companies that are good at the domain that they are working in.
Their model might be proprietary, the data might be proprietary, but the infrastructure doesn't necessarily need to be proprietary and we can give them just an easy way to deploy that stuff without many, many people months.
